Direct Access to Regional Destinations via Private Jet Charter
Marquette and Central UP: Sawyer International Airport serves Pictured Rocks National Lakeshore, downtown Marquette, and Lake Superior’s south shore. Private flights eliminate the three-hour drive from Green Bay or Traverse City that commercial connections require.
Keweenaw Peninsula: Houghton County Memorial Airport provides direct access to Copper Harbor, winter sports areas, and the region receiving over 200 inches of annual snowfall. Skip the additional two-hour drive from Marquette.
Wisconsin Northwoods: Rhinelander-Oneida County Airport sits in the heart of lake country, minutes from Eagle River, Minocqua, and thousands of fishing lakes that define the region.
Western UP: Ironwood’s Gogebic-Iron County Airport serves the Porcupine Mountains, Lake Superior’s western shore, and remote wilderness areas with minimal commercial service.
Understanding Private Jet Charter Costs and Timing
Charter rates vary based on departure city, aircraft type, and group size. Chicago to Marquette typically ranges $7,500 to $10,000 one-way for a light jet (1h 45m flight). Detroit to Marquette runs $6,800 to $9,500 (1h 30m). Six people splitting costs brings per-person pricing to $1,200-1,600 round-trip.
Peak fall color weeks (late September through early October) and winter holidays see higher demand. Turboprop aircraft cost less than jets and work fine for these short distances. Last-minute bookings within 24-48 hours typically cost more, but provide the flexibility to respond to optimal fishing reports, unexpected powder, or perfect color forecasts.
When It Makes Sense
Private charter to the UP and Northern Wisconsin isn’t for everyone. Single weekend trips for one or two people probably don’t justify the cost. But the economics shift for multiple annual trips to owned property, groups of six to eight splitting costs, older family members who can’t handle six-hour drives, or travelers who need to respond to time-sensitive conditions like ice-out timing or fall color peaks.
The calculation isn’t purely financial. It’s about what you value. If maximizing time in the actual wilderness matters more than travel cost, private aviation makes sense. If the drive is part of the experience, it probably doesn’t.
